Problem at end of Burn/Verification - EVERY TIME - Version: 2.81, 11/12/2005 08:42AM PST
Truth w Christ
I have been unable to get past the first DVD (1 of 27) in my attempt to archive data.
Impression does all the right stuff - until at the end of "verify burn", it says there was / is an error in my optical drive. I use a dual 2.7 G5 and have never had any problems w my optical drive.
I tried an alternate burner (external Pioneer) and it also gets same error!
